MITIGATION ACTIVITIES is a federal award for W071 Endist Omaha held by Hgl-Aptim Applied Science and Technology Jv, LLC. Estimated value $5.8M ($5.2M obligated). Current period of performance ends Sep 22, 2026. Place of performance: PHOENIX AZ. Related solicitation W9128F20R0046.
